Output 3dcb12b1a87e5f66113564744ba70d18c1aca6b4ecb441c0ea0b8e61417989ec:1

value
41044696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985a01b115745b8094a3a4b7cff863443b441e6f OP_EQUAL
address
MMnimMfrehJq5rwXgs1pNTiLPWD7LrtnWt
transaction
3dcb12b1a87e5f66113564744ba70d18c1aca6b4ecb441c0ea0b8e61417989ec
spent
true